Flask之初學者(二)
阿新 • • 發佈:2018-07-03
技術 mysql pytho username g模式 ron import info 字符串格式化
Flask配置文件
在項目文件夾下新建一個“config”py文件,在代碼中“import config”後使用“app.config.from_object(config)”即可使用配置文件中的參數(需大寫),例如:
- DEBUG:設置為“True”時表示開啟debug模式,設置為“False”表示關閉debug模式;
- SQLALCHEMY_DATABASE_URI:設置數據庫連接字符串(這裏使用的是sqlalchemy插件),字符串形式是固定的,為“dialect+driver://username:password@host:port/database”,比如MySQL的連接字符串可以如圖配置(其中的花括號是Python的一種字符串格式化,就像“%”使用一樣):
1 # 數據庫連接固定格式格式字符串 2 # dialect+driver://username:password@host:port/database 3 DIALECT = ‘mysql‘ 4 DRIVER = ‘mysqldb‘ 5 USERNAME = ‘root‘ 6 PASSWORD = 123456 7 HOST = ‘127.0.0.1‘ 8 PORT = ‘3306‘ 9 DATABASE = ‘db_demo1‘ 10 11 SQLALCHEMY_DATABASE_URI = ‘{dialect}+{driver}://{username}:{password}@{host}:{port}/{database}?charset=utf8‘.format( 12 dialect=DIALECT, driver=DRIVER, username=USERNAME, password=PASSWORD, host=HOST, port=PORT, database=DATABASE 13 )
Flask之初學者(二)